It is with heavy hearts that we announce the passing of our sassy, funny, smart and caring mother, grandmother, sister and friend Judy Joyce Tittle Airgood on February 22, 2023.

Judy loved and devoted her life to her family and in caring for others. She made sure all birthdays and holidays were celebrated with good food, family and fun. She enjoyed traveling and was always up for an adventure. Judy had a huge personality and was a friend to everyone, always willing to help others. Her laughter, jokes, compassion and light will forever be missed.

Born to Earl and Lois Tittle in California, she moved to Illinois as a young child and remained there until moving to North Carolina in 2000.

Judy is preceded by her beloved husband Gene Airgood, whom she was married to for 28 years along with her parents and sister Darla Weaver.
She is survived by siblings Don Tittle (Sharon), Larise Giasson (Roger), Doug Tittle, Mike Tittle, Trish Pope (Mikel), Debbie Bailey.

Judy will be greatly missed by her 3 children Angie Anderson, Jim Airgood and Alicia Chrisman (Joshua) in addition to several children which she fostered. Judy loved being a grandmother to Aliza, Taylor, Liam, Julie, Jacob, Nicholas and Matthew who will all greatly miss her unconditional love, support and encouragement. Judy is survived by many nieces, nephews, extended family and her loving partner Darrell Lloyd.

A celebration of life will be held March 11, 2023. Details will be updated on the Shumate-Faulk Funeral Home website.
